This episode, Those Old Fossils begins a brand-new series exploring the pilots of the Millennium Falcon, and to kick things off we’re looking at ship itself- Kenner’s vintage Millennium Falcon from 1979.
Widely regarded as one of the most iconic vehicles in the original Star Wars toy line, the Falcon became the centrepiece of countless childhood collections and remains a cornerstone of vintage Star Wars collecting today.
Ron Salvatore from the Star Wars Collectors Archive returns to share his expertise on the toy’s development, design, play features, Zendaya and it's lasting appeal
The team explore what made the Falcon such a special release and why it continues to be one of the most beloved items in the Kenner range.
The discussion also covers international releases, packaging variations, current market prices, and related Falcon items, including the die-cast and Micro Collection versions, as well as where the Falcon featured beyond the toys.
Whether you owned one as a child or still have one proudly displayed on your shelf, this episode celebrates a true classic of the vintage Star Wars line.
